游戏开发中的引擎和工具
随着游戏产业的快速发展,游戏开发工具的更新换代速度也越来越快。各类开发引擎、工具和素材库也越来越多,开发者可以根据自己的需求和技术性来进行选择。
引擎的选择
在游戏制作的过程中,引擎是最基本的工具。引擎主要有自然界引擎(如物理引擎、细节引擎等)、人工智能引擎和使用者界面引擎等。不同类型的引擎在制作过程中各自发挥不同的作用。
目前,Unity、Unreal Engine、CryEngine、Lumberyard和GameMaker等引擎被广泛使用。各个引擎各有长处,例如,Unity易上手,适合小规模的游戏制作,且免费版较为完善;而Unreal Engine则适合大规模制作,具有强大的可拓展性和高品质的渲染效果。
但是,在选择引擎时,开发者应该根据自身的需求、技术水平和团队能力来进行选择,避免盲目跟风。
工具的应用
除了引擎之外,开发者还需要使用各种工具进行制作。例如,画面编辑器、取样器、模型编辑器、音频编辑器、渲染器等等。
其中比较常用的工具有Adobe Photoshop、Maya、Blender等。Adobe Photoshop被广泛应用于图形制作;而Maya和Blender则是制作3D模型及动画的常用工具。此外,还有使用线框图进行渲染的ShaderForge插件等。
javascript游戏引擎当然,在选择工具时,我们需要按照自己的专业需求和工作习惯等方面进行考虑,每个人都有不同的上手难度和学习曲线。
素材的来源
出于时间和精力上的考虑,开发者通常会寻一些现成的素材来使用。现成的素材库通常包含图片、音频、模型、动画等各类资源。商业和免费的素材库都有,但是使用素材时要遵循素材的使用协议,避免版权问题。
常见的素材库有CGTrader、TurboSquid等,素材种类丰富,但价格相对较高;而The3DStudio、OpenGameArt、Freesound等则提供免费素材。这些库都有优缺点,要根
据自己的需求进行选择。
考虑到自己的游戏内容和美术特点,开发者也可以自己创作素材。一些设计软件如Procreate、REAPER、Avid Pro Tools等能够为开发者提供更好的创作环境和工具支持。
结语
随着游戏产业的飞速发展,游戏制作的过程也在不断变化。选择恰当的引擎和工具可以加速游戏开发和提高游戏品质,而优秀的素材则可以带来更出的视觉和听觉体验。提高开发者自身的技术水平,深度挖掘各种工具和素材的潜力,是制作一款优秀游戏的关键。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。